The Coombs Fair, first held in 1913, has been celebrating agriculture in Oceanside for almost 90 years. The fair features animals' barns, domestic science, horticulture, art displays, and more. Enjoy the music stage, relax with homemade pie and tea or grab a burger from the concession. On Ford Road in Coombs, turn at the General Store.
